You will need this permit to sell or offer goods for sale in a public place. A public place is any road or land owned or controlled by your local council. Activities that can be conducted under this permit include:
A licence defines the need to obtain recognition / certification and registration to undertake a certain business activity.
You may need to hold a public liability insurance policy, typically with $20 million cover.
